Seasonal Home Maintenance Checklist to Preserve Property Value

Seasonal Home Maintenance Checklist to Preserve Property Value: Essential Year-Round Tasks for Protecting Your Investment

Maintaining a home through seasonal cycles helps preserve value and keeps systems running smoothly in La Crescenta, CA. Local climate includes warm, dry summers and mild, wet winters that influence maintenance needs. Regular care protects landscaping, structural components, and mechanical systems. The following sections cover essential seasonal tasks with practical instructions and location-specific notes for La Crescenta residents.

Spring Exterior Inspection And Roof Care

Spring is an ideal season to inspect roofs after the rainy period. Walk the perimeter to look for missing or damaged shingles and loose flashing around chimneys and vents. A binocular inspection from the ground helps identify obvious issues without climbing. If tile roofing is present, check for cracked or displaced tiles and remove debris from valleys where water flows. Hire a licensed roofing contractor for repairs beyond minor adjustments. Clear gutters and downspouts of winter accumulation so spring rains drain properly. Confirm that downspout extensions direct water away from foundations to prevent soil erosion on sloped lots common around La Crescenta.

Spring Landscaping And Drainage Management

Focus on irrigation and grading before summer heat arrives. Trim back shrubs and trees that touch the house to improve air circulation and reduce pest entry points. Prune deciduous species after new growth appears to support healthy structure. Inspect sprinker heads for misalignment and broken nozzles. Adjust irrigation timers for longer intervals as temperatures rise, while keeping soil health in mind. Check grading around the home so runoff moves away from foundations; add soil or install French drains where needed on properties with shallow slopes or limited setbacks.

Summer Exterior Painting And Siding Maintenance

Warm weather provides optimal conditions for exterior painting and siding repairs. Clean siding with a low-pressure wash to remove dust and pollen that accumulate during spring. Evaluate paint for chalking, cracking, or blistering and touch up or repaint surfaces that show wear. For stucco exteriors, look for hairline cracks and fill them with elastomeric sealant to prevent moisture intrusion. Inspect caulking around windows and doors and replace any that is hard or missing to maintain energy efficiency and protect interior finishes.

Summer Cooling System Service And Energy Efficiency

Service air conditioning equipment before peak demand. Replace or clean filters and check refrigerant levels while the system runs to confirm proper cooling performance. Clean condenser coils and remove debris that restricts airflow. Ensure that attic vents are unobstructed to support heat escape and reduce load on cooling systems in homes with attics common to La Crescenta architecture. Consider installing programmable thermostats to optimize energy use during long warm spells. Shade south and west facing windows with awnings or deciduous plantings to reduce solar gain.

Fall Gutter Cleaning And Chimney Preparation

Clear gutters of leaves and pine needles that arrive with seasonal winds. Confirm that gutters are securely fastened and pitched to channel water toward downspouts. Inspect chimney caps and screens and remove bird nests or other obstructions. Schedule a professional chimney sweep if fireplaces are used regularly. Inspect attic spaces for signs of roof leaks and repair underlayment as needed. Secure outdoor furniture and protect exposed metal elements from overnight cool snaps that can accelerate corrosion.

Fall Heating System Check And Fireplace Readiness

Service furnaces and heating elements before weather turns cooler. Replace filters and test ignition or pilot systems for reliable operation. Balance ductwork so each living area receives adequate airflow during heating cycles. For wood-burning fireplaces, ensure damper operation and inspect firebrick for wear. Stock seasoned firewood in a dry location away from the structure to prevent pest intrusion. Check carbon monoxide and smoke detectors for battery operation and replace components that have exceeded manufacturer guidelines.

Winter Plumbing Protection And Insulation Review

Although winters are mild in La Crescenta, occasional cool periods can stress plumbing. Insulate exposed pipes in crawlspaces and near exterior walls to prevent thermal stress. Verify that water supply shutoff valves are accessible and operate smoothly in case of emergency. Evaluate attic and wall insulation levels to maintain consistent interior temperatures and reduce energy use. Seal gaps around penetrations for plumbing and electrical services to limit heat loss and entry points for small wildlife.

Winter Window And Door Sealing

Inspect weatherstripping and door sweeps for compression set or separation. Replace worn components to maintain thermal comfort and control humidity levels. For older single pane windows, consider adding interior storm panels for improved comfort during cool nights without altering exterior appearance. Clean window tracks and lubricate sliding hardware so windows operate freely. Confirm that exterior door thresholds are secured and that sill pans direct water away from the building envelope.

Year-Round Pest Prevention And Exterior Lighting

Maintain landscaping that discourages pests by keeping mulch away from foundation walls and removing wood piles from close proximity to the home. Seal gaps greater than one quarter inch around utility penetrations and foundation vents. Install or maintain exterior lighting with motion sensors to reduce nocturnal pest attraction and improve deterrence for larger wildlife. Inspect attic and crawlspace penetrations periodically for signs of chewed insulation or droppings and engage a licensed pest management professional for humane exclusion measures.

Seasonal Documentation And Maintenance Scheduling

Create a simple record of completed tasks and dates to track maintenance history and stay ahead of recurring needs. Photograph areas of concern before and after repairs for reference during resale or warranty claims. Coordinate with a trusted real estate agent when planning major improvements to confirm alignment with local buyer preferences and market expectations in La Crescenta. Schedule recurring inspections with licensed professionals for systems that require periodic certification or calibration. Maintain receipts and manuals in a centralized folder for easy access during ownership transitions.
